Several customers report duplicate and conflicting events after syncing between Meridel and the Castwick scheduler. Investigation shows the sync workers in the eastern cluster are running an older conflict-resolution policy than the western cluster, so the same event pair is resolved differently depending on which worker handles it. This is drift, not a code bug: the deploy pipeline skipped a config push last Thursday. For support triage, the values currently active on the drifted workers are listed below.

service settings:
[casax]
port = 6379
team = rusir
host = casax.zemvarhq.corp
region = outer-4
access_code = ac_9808ce
timeout_ms = 1500

## Artifact Signing — Glimmerpane Admin Dashboard

All dark-mode builds of the Glimmerpane admin dashboard ship as signed bundles. The theme assets (tokens.css, palette maps) are included in the signed payload — do not patch them post-build. Unsigned bundles are rejected by the Hollowmark deploy gate. Verify every bundle before upload using the signing key provided below.

release key, fahaf-bajof: bky3_Xam

## Deployment

This section covers deploying the Bramblewood API with the new GraphQL N+1 fix. Previously, nested author-to-article resolvers issued a separate database query per node; the fix introduces request-scoped batching so each depth level resolves in a single round trip. New team members should deploy to the canary cell first and watch resolver latency for at least thirty minutes before promoting. Rollback is a single redeploy of the prior tag. The service reads its batching and pool settings from the values below.

settings of fafog-haduf:
ZORIX_PIN=4648
ZORIX_METRICS_HOST=metrics.zorix.paliqsys.corp
ZORIX_LOG_LEVEL=info
ZORIX_TENANT=druix

Subject: Password reset revamp shipping tonight — what support should know

Hi support team,

Tonight we release the revamped password reset flow for Quillgate. Key changes: reset links now expire after 20 minutes instead of 24 hours, users get a plain-language confirmation screen, and repeated requests are rate-limited with a friendly cooldown message. Expect some tickets from users with stale links; ask them to request a fresh one. Full FAQ is on the internal wiki. When escalating, please quote the build token shown below.

session token of tajef-bageg = htk21_5d90d574934f3ccae6437